Another Giant Stride from Pryke

by isleofman.com 25th February 2010

19 year old athlete Harriet Pryke is even nearer qualifying for the Commonwealth Games in Delhi later this year.

Yesterday, she set yet another personal best in the 400 metres at the National Indoor Arena in Birmingham.

Running for Brunel University in an inter-varsity match, she clocked a new personal best of 55.78 seconds knocking 1.5 seconds off the time set a few weeks ago.

She needs a time of around 55.2 seconds to be considered for the Isle of Man team to go to India in October.

But times outdoor are in general much quicker than those indoor so she is making real progress.

Harriet's final indoor run will be at the British University Indoor Championships next month - her first outdoor competition is an international meeting in Malta in April.
